The term "chromatogram" suggests a plot attained via chromatography. Fig.4 exhibits an example of a chromatogram. The chromatogram is a two-dimensional plot with the vertical axis exhibiting focus regarding the detector sign depth as well as the horizontal axis symbolizing the analysis time. When no compounds are eluted through the column, a line parallel to the horizontal axis is plotted. This is certainly called the baseline.

When HPLC is utilised, a recognized dilemma here is carryover of specimen from a person specimen to the next. Such as, if the first specimen belongs to some individual with sickle mobile sickness (Hb SS), then a small peak could possibly be seen with the “S” window in the following specimen. This may result in diagnostic confusion together with the sample becoming re-run. Approximate retention situations of prevalent hemoglobins in a typical HPLC analysis are summarized in Table 4.six.
